Blazing Bright Smiles: The Ultimate Blaze Toothbrush Timer Guide

A blaze toothbrush timer is designed to help you achieve a full two minutes of brushing while evenly covering every zone in your mouth.

By turning each quadrant session into a visible countdown, this smart timer encourages consistent technique and reduces the risk of missed spots.

How the Blaze Toothbrush Timer Organizes Your Routine

The internal timer coordinates with micro-movements to keep your brushing rhythm steady.

When the device senses a new quadrant, it shifts the light ring or handle pulse to guide your next motion.

This directional guidance trains you to cover every tooth surface instead of rushing through comfortable areas.

Tracking Your Coverage with Blaze Analytics

Many models log each session so you can review patterns over days and weeks using a companion app.

You can see which zones need more attention and adjust your technique based on clear graphs and scores.

Optimizing Daily Use

  • Place the charger within sight so you remember to top up the battery each night.
  • Check the app weekly to spot zones where coverage drops below ideal levels.
  • Replace the brush head at least every three months to maintain precise motion tracking.
  • Use gentle pressure and let the timer do the pacing instead of rushing the beeps.
  • Keep the sensor area clean so motion detection and pause features stay accurate.

Why does the timer keep pausing when I brush my back teeth?

The motion sensor interprets reduced movement as a pause and automatically freezes the timer, so you do not lose time while reaching difficult areas.

Can I shorten the session if I only have one minute before work?

The system is calibrated for a full two minutes, and skipping the recommended duration reduces cleaning effectiveness, so try to complete the full cycle.

Do pressure alerts really protect my gums?

Yes, brief warnings when you apply too much force help prevent gum recession and enamel wear over time.
